Vattensonder, meaning "water probes" in Swedish, is a term that can refer to several types of devices used for measuring or interacting with water. In a scientific or engineering context, it most commonly denotes a submersible sensor designed to collect data about water quality and characteristics. These probes can measure parameters such as temperature, pH, dissolved oxygen, conductivity, turbidity, and depth. They are vital tools in environmental monitoring, hydrology, oceanography, and aquaculture, providing essential information for understanding aquatic ecosystems, managing water resources, and detecting pollution.
